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Jak odczytać dane z pliku textowego
Forum PHP.pl > Forum > PHP
ekarina
Oto kod:

<?php
$dane="sciezka/dane.txt";
$fp = fopen($plik,"r");
$pom = fgets($fp);
$line = explode(",",$pom);
$trzeci_el = $line[2];
$piaty_el = $line[4];
fclose($fp);

echo "Karina<br>";
echo "$trzeci_el<br>";
echo "$piaty_el<br>";
echo "Karina<br>";
echo "Karina";

?>

w pliku dane są liczby: 123456789
Chce odczytać 2 i 4 i wyskakuje błąd

http://karina.e-vip.pl/sc/odczyt.php
Proszę pomocy?questionmark.gif
donpablo
po pierwsze w tym kodzie który podajesz jest błąd w funkcji fopen bo jak możesz otworzyć plik nie podając ścieżki, jeśli ścieżke wpisujesz pod zmienną $dane to do funkcji fopen podajesz własnie ją: fopen($dane, "r") a nie jakiś $plik, ponadto dobrze jest funkcji fgets podać drugi opcjonalny argument np. fgets($fp,255)
popraw i bedzie hulac
Ociu
Przy okazji używaj odpowiednie BBCode.
aleksander
ekarina
dziękuje działa:)
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.